Obesity and Man Boobs



Many people mistakenly think that man boobs, or gynecomastia, is caused by obesity. This, actually, isn’t true at all. It is true that being obese can make a man have the appearance of having man boobs, but in reality, gynecomastia is actually a condition that exists because of an underlying health problem, which does not include obesity.

The man boobs that appear because of obesity are actually made up of fat in the chest area, or chest fat. By losing the weight, and working out, a man can easily get rid of the chest fat, and make the man boobs disappear.

On the other hand, if the man boobs are caused by gynecomastia, the underlying health condition must be identified and treated first, although the condition is not always caused by a health condition, per se. It can also be caused by medications taken for a health condition, including illegal drugs which are abused, as well as alcoholism, which in fact could be considered a health problem.

So, if you have the appearance of man boobs, the first thing you must do is rule out gynecomastia by visiting your doctor for an exam. It is always helpful to your doctor if you can tell him how much – in inches – your man boobs have grown over a certain period of time. This information will help him to diagnose gynecomastia or chest fat, as the situation dictates.

Your doctor may still need to perform a series of exams and/or tests to determine if any medical condition exists that could be causing your man boobs, unless the cause – obesity – is evident. Even then, there could still be an underlying health issue that must be dealt with. These health issues could be anything from a thyroid problem to cancer to a problem with your liver. If the male is in his teens, the man boobs could be caused by simple puberty, and in most of these cases, the situation is rectified once puberty has passed, without medical intervention.

If chest fat is diagnosed as the cause of your man boobs, remember that you can do something about it. In most cases, you need to change your diet and start exercising regularly. Not only do you need to exercise for the purpose of burning off fat and calories, you also need to do body building and body toning exercises to regain the manly chest that you once had.

Furthermore, it is important to note that man boobs caused by chest fat have a slightly different appearance than man boobs caused by gynecomastia. Those caused by chest fat look more like rolls of fat, man boobs that are actually gynecomastia look more like actual female breasts.

If you feel like you are in need of a bra, and you are male, it is probably past time to see a doctor. Note, however, that regardless of the cause of your man boobs, there is usually something that can be done about it, with the proper diagnosis and treatment.
